Men have long been a prominent presence in the world of cinema, shaping narratives and reflecting societal norms and expectations. From classic Hollywood portrayals of rugged heroes to modern depictions of nuanced and multifaceted characters, the representation of men in film has evolved over time, offering insight into changing cultural attitudes and perceptions.

Historically, men in film were often depicted according to traditional gender stereotypes, with characters embodying traits such as strength, dominance, and stoicism. These archetypal portrayals reinforced societal norms surrounding masculinity, presenting a narrow and idealized image of what it means to be a man.

While such representations may have resonated with audiences at the time, they also perpetuated harmful stereotypes and limited the range of male experiences depicted on screen.

In recent years, however, there has been a noticeable shift in the portrayal of men in film, with filmmakers increasingly exploring the complexities of male identity and masculinity. From sensitive and introspective protagonists to flawed and vulnerable antiheroes, contemporary cinema has embraced a more nuanced and inclusive approach to depicting male characters. This evolution reflects broader societal changes and challenges traditional notions of masculinity, allowing for greater diversity and representation in storytelling.

One notable trend in contemporary cinema is the exploration of male vulnerability and emotional expression. Films such as “Moonlight” and “Call Me by Your Name” have received widespread acclaim for their sensitive and authentic portrayal of male characters grappling with issues of identity, desire, and intimacy. By depicting men who defy traditional gender norms and embrace their vulnerability, these films challenge audiences to reconsider their preconceptions about masculinity and empathize with the complexities of the male experience.

Another emerging theme in modern cinema is the deconstruction of traditional power dynamics and gender roles. Films like “Get Out” and “Sorry to Bother You” subvert expectations by featuring protagonists who navigate systems of oppression and exploitation, often with a sense of humor and self-awareness. These films confront audiences with uncomfortable truths about privilege and systemic inequality while offering a fresh perspective on the challenges faced by men in contemporary society.

In conclusion, the portrayal of men in film has undergone a significant transformation over the years, from reinforcing traditional stereotypes to embracing complexity and diversity. While traditional archetypes still persist in some corners of cinema, there is a growing recognition of the need for more nuanced and inclusive representations of male characters. By exploring themes of vulnerability, identity, and power, contemporary filmmakers are challenging audiences to rethink their assumptions about masculinity and engage with a richer and more authentic portrayal of men on screen.
